99精品伊人亚洲|最近国产中文炮友|九草在线视频支援|AV网站大全最新|美女黄片免费观看|国产精品资源视频|精彩无码视频一区|91大神在线后入|伊人终合在线播放|久草综合久久中文

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

python開源庫之twisted defer簡析

冬至配餃子 ? 來源:繆斯之子 ? 作者:肖新苗 ? 2022-08-19 18:16 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

目錄

addCallback和callback

addCallbacks和errback

addBoth

defer鏈

defer立即執(zhí)行

succeed用法

defer異步

maybeDeferred適用場景

1.addCallback和callback

addcallback: 增加回調(diào)函數(shù)

callback: 觸發(fā)回調(diào)函數(shù)

pYYBAGL_YfOAL4oiAABbs5jJ_CY246.png

2.addCallbacks和errback

addcallbacks: 觸發(fā)異常的時候, 進(jìn)入第二個參數(shù)

errback: 觸發(fā)異?;卣{(diào)

poYBAGL_YgSAZV-xAAB2cIYm9PM851.png

3.addBoth

addBoth: 類似try catch鏈里面的finally

poYBAGL_YiSAQ_PzAACUqEXcG8s295.pngpYYBAGL_YiqAcQyZAABu-a-k7_w178.png

4.defer鏈

pYYBAGL_Yj-AQNp7AACWsMW7G-s950.png

5.defer立即執(zhí)行

callback在addcallback的前面

poYBAGL_YlWAVCMKAACVRjdnGcE177.png

6.succeed用法

返回一個已經(jīng)激活的defer

poYBAGL_YmeAWBgCAACPrdIIASg505.png

7.defer異步

defer異步的實現(xiàn)方式: defer里面嵌套另外的defer

poYBAGL_YoaALdGSAACrYdMVwO8654.pngpoYBAGL_YoyAKGSZAAA7DKqUrok058.png

8.maybeDeferred適用場景

maybeDeferred適用場景: 不確定返回值是defer還是一般的值, 但是又期望返回值是defer

注: 如果是Deferred對象原樣返回, 如果是一般的值, 則包裝成激活的Deferred再返回

pYYBAGL_YrSASs-qAACggha_4TU012.pngpoYBAGL_YrmANfm7AAAOaD91Qiw005.png


審核編輯:劉清

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• python
    +關(guān)注

    關(guān)注

    56

    文章

    4827

    瀏覽量

    86800
  • 回調(diào)函數(shù)
    +關(guān)注

    關(guān)注

    0

    文章

    88

    瀏覽量

    11897
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關(guān)推薦
    熱點推薦

    Modbus與MQTT的區(qū)別

    Modbus和MQTT是工業(yè)領(lǐng)域中兩種不同的通信協(xié)議,在設(shè)計目標(biāo)、應(yīng)用場景、通信模式等方面存在顯著差異,以下從多個維度兩者的區(qū)別: 1.設(shè)計目標(biāo)與起源 Modbus 誕生于1979年,由施耐德
    的頭像 發(fā)表于 07-10 14:10 ?157次閱讀

    沐曦GPU跑通DeepSeek開源代碼FlashMLA

    今日,DeepSeek正式啟動"開源周"計劃,首發(fā)代碼FlashMLA一經(jīng)開源即引發(fā)全網(wǎng)關(guān)注。截至發(fā)稿,該項目已在GitHub斬獲超7.2K Star!
    的頭像 發(fā)表于 02-25 16:25 ?874次閱讀

    AI開源模型有什么用

    AI開源模型作為推動AI技術(shù)發(fā)展的重要力量,正深刻改變著我們的生產(chǎn)生活方式。接下來,AI部落小編帶您了解AI開源模型有什么用。
    的頭像 發(fā)表于 02-24 11:50 ?439次閱讀

    開源大模型DeepSeek的開放內(nèi)容詳

    當(dāng)大家討論為什么 DeepSeek 能夠形成全球刷屏之勢,讓所有廠商、平臺都集成之時,「開源」成為了最大的關(guān)鍵詞之一,圖靈獎得主 Yann LeCun 稱其是「開源的勝利」。模型開源一直備受關(guān)注,從
    的頭像 發(fā)表于 02-19 09:48 ?1468次閱讀
    <b class='flag-5'>開源</b>大模型DeepSeek的開放內(nèi)容詳<b class='flag-5'>析</b>

    使用Python實現(xiàn)xgboost教程

    裝: bash復(fù)制代碼conda install -c conda-forge xgboost 2. 導(dǎo)入必要的 在你的Python腳本或Jupyter Notebook中,導(dǎo)入必要的
    的頭像 發(fā)表于 01-19 11:21 ?1385次閱讀

    適用于MySQL和MariaDB的Python連接器:可靠的MySQL數(shù)據(jù)連接器和數(shù)據(jù)

    和 MariaDB 數(shù)據(jù)服務(wù)器以及托管數(shù)據(jù)服務(wù),以對存儲的數(shù)據(jù)執(zhí)行創(chuàng)建、讀取、更新和刪除操作。該解決方案完全實現(xiàn)了 Python DB API 2.0 規(guī)范,并作為 Windows、macOS
    的頭像 發(fā)表于 01-17 12:18 ?501次閱讀
    適用于MySQL和MariaDB的<b class='flag-5'>Python</b>連接器:可靠的MySQL數(shù)據(jù)連接器和數(shù)據(jù)<b class='flag-5'>庫</b>

    適用于Oracle的Python連接器:可訪問托管以及非托管的數(shù)據(jù)

    適用于 Oracle 的 Python 連接器 適用于 Oracle 的 Python 連接器是一種可靠的連接解決方案,用于從 Python 應(yīng)用程序訪問 Oracle 數(shù)據(jù)服務(wù)器和
    的頭像 發(fā)表于 01-14 10:30 ?477次閱讀

    開源AI模型是干嘛的

    開源AI模型是指那些公開源代碼、允許自由訪問和使用的AI模型集合。這些模型通常經(jīng)過訓(xùn)練,能夠執(zhí)行特定的任務(wù)。以下,是對開源AI模型的詳細(xì)
    的頭像 發(fā)表于 12-14 10:33 ?794次閱讀

    使用Python進(jìn)行串口通信的案例

    當(dāng)然!以下是一個使用Python進(jìn)行串口通信的簡單示例。這個示例展示了如何配置串口、發(fā)送數(shù)據(jù)以及接收數(shù)據(jù)。我們將使用 pyserial ,這是一個非常流行的用于串口通信的Python
    的頭像 發(fā)表于 11-22 09:11 ?1474次閱讀

    儀科技第九屆開源測控開發(fā)者大會精彩回顧

    儀科技主辦的第九屆開源測控開發(fā)者大會,近日在上海圓滿落幕。
    的頭像 發(fā)表于 11-19 09:16 ?816次閱讀

    如何使用Python構(gòu)建LSTM神經(jīng)網(wǎng)絡(luò)模型

    構(gòu)建一個LSTM(長短期記憶)神經(jīng)網(wǎng)絡(luò)模型是一個涉及多個步驟的過程。以下是使用Python和Keras構(gòu)建LSTM模型的指南。 1. 安裝必要的 首先,確保你已經(jīng)安裝了Python
    的頭像 發(fā)表于 11-13 10:10 ?1584次閱讀

    Python解析:通過實現(xiàn)代理請求與數(shù)據(jù)抓取

    Python中,有多個可以幫助你實現(xiàn)代理請求和數(shù)據(jù)抓取。這些提供了豐富的功能和靈活的API,使得你可以輕松地發(fā)送HTTP請求、處理響應(yīng)、解析HTML/XML/JSON數(shù)據(jù),以及進(jìn)行復(fù)雜的網(wǎng)絡(luò)操作。
    的頭像 發(fā)表于 10-24 07:54 ?487次閱讀

    儀科技與您相約第九屆開源測控開發(fā)者大會

    第九屆開源測控開發(fā)者大會,儀科技將繼續(xù)秉承開放、創(chuàng)新的精神,深入探討模塊測控領(lǐng)域軟件的重要性,并展示基于開源銳視測控平臺的實踐應(yīng)用,帶來豐富的議題分享。
    的頭像 發(fā)表于 10-21 11:35 ?781次閱讀

    如何幫助孩子高效學(xué)習(xí)Python:開源硬件實踐是最優(yōu)選擇

    顯著提升孩子的學(xué)習(xí)興趣和對Python原理的理解。本文將探討為何使用Raspberry Pi(樹莓派)或Unihiker(行空板)等開源硬件是孩子們掌握Python的最佳途徑。 讓孩子們在Py
    的頭像 發(fā)表于 09-06 09:49 ?679次閱讀

    Python建模算法與應(yīng)用

    Python作為一種功能強(qiáng)大、免費、開源且面向?qū)ο蟮木幊陶Z言,在科學(xué)計算、數(shù)學(xué)建模、數(shù)據(jù)分析等領(lǐng)域展現(xiàn)出了卓越的性能。其簡潔的語法、對動態(tài)輸入的支持以及解釋性語言的本質(zhì),使得Python在多個平臺
    的頭像 發(fā)表于 07-24 10:41 ?1274次閱讀